Discover Laos, a land of serene beauty and vibrant culture. Experience the magic of Boun That Luang, a spectacular Buddhist festival in November, or the lively Pi Mai Lao, the Lao New Year celebration in April. Immerse yourself in the soulful sounds of Laos with artists like Palysa, whose folk-infused melodies capture the nation's spirit, or the infectious energy of modern pop stars. Traditional Lao music, with its distinctive *khene* instrument, forms the heart of many celebrations, often blending with contemporary genres like rock and hip-hop for a truly unique soundscape. Tune into Lao National Radio for the latest news and discussions shaping the nation, keeping you connected to the pulse of everyday life. Savor the exquisite flavors of Lao cuisine, from the fiery zest of *laap*, a minced meat salad, to the sticky comfort of *khao niao* (sticky rice), a staple enjoyed with every meal.
